Scantronic 9827 alarm system - help needed
Hi. I have a house alarm system that utilises a Scantronic 9827 control panel. I have tried to omit a PIR using "code, then zone, then X PIR NUMBER" as per the user manual but it doesn't work. After reading the manual again, it does suggest that the installer needs to program any PIR to be 'omittable' before I can omit it!
I've just had the installer out to reprogram the zones last week, and I'm slightly embarrased to have to ask him to come out again and re-program it again! Does anyone out there have an installer manual (or can tell me how to do it) so I can omit PIR number 5. (It's the room where I put my dog when I go out, and she keeps setting the alarm off)! I only want to omit the PIR on occasion, and the user manual tells me that this is a temporary thing which only lasts for a single setting/disabling cycle, which is exactly what I want!
